Brief summary

The aim of the study is to assess the safety and efficacy of the use of the Eximo's B-Laser™ catheter in subjects affected with Peripheral Artery Disease (PAD) in lower extremity arteries.

Detailed description

This is a prospective, single-arm, multi-center, international, open-label, non-randomized clinical study. All enrolled subjects will undergo atherectomy procedure, during which the B-Laser™ catheter will be used to perform atherectomy in target lesion, followed by any other adjunctive therapy (balloon and/or stent etc.). The procedure will be done according to standard hospital procedure for atherectomy. The steps of the operation before and after the operating of the B-Laser™ device are routinely used practice and will be done according to local practice at each hospital. For the post-atherectomy stage, as an adjunctive therapy in the procedure, any approved device may be used (balloon and/or stent etc.). Subjects will then be followed for 12 months after the procedure.

Interventions

DEVICEB-Laser™ Atherectomy Catheter

Laser atherectomy catheter based on 355 nm

Change in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baselinebaseline and 30 days, 6 months and 12 months post procedureChange in Ankle-Brachial Index (ABI) post B-Laser™ device procedure compared to baseline. ABI is calculated as the ratio of the ankle blood pressure to the arm blood pressure. The normal value ranges between 0.9 to 1.3. The change is calculated as the value at the later time point minus the value at the earlier time point, when positive results represent increases while negative results represent decrease, so higher ABI score at the later time point represents an improvement through time and vice versa.

Change in Rutherford Classification Post B-Laser™ Device Procedure Compared to Baselinebaseline and 30 days, 6 months and 12 months post procedureChange in Rutherford Classification Post B-Laser™ Device Procedure Compared to Baseline. Rutherford Classification has seven stages, from Stage 0 to Stage 6, when the lower value indicate a better outcome: 0= Asymptomatic; 1= Mild claudication; 2= Moderate claudication; 3= Severe claudication; 4= Rest pain; 5= Ischemic ulceration not exceeding ulcer of the digits of the foot; 6= Severe ischemic ulcers or frank gangrene. The change is calculated as the value at the later time point minus the value at the earlier time point, when positive results represent decrease while negative results represent increases, so lower Rutherford score at the later time point represents an improvement through time and vice versa.

Secondary

Change in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baseline

Change in Ankle-Brachial Index (ABI) post B-Laser™ device procedure compared to baseline. ABI is calculated as the ratio of the ankle blood pressure to the arm blood pressure. The normal value ranges between 0.9 to 1.3. The change is calculated as the value at the later time point minus the value at the earlier time point, when positive results represent increases while negative results represent decrease, so higher ABI score at the later time point represents an improvement through time and vice versa.

Time frame: baseline and 30 days, 6 months and 12 months post procedure

Population: The number analyzed in one or more rows differs from overall number since it excludes missing data at different time-points

ArmMeasureGroupValue (MEAN)Dispersion
B-Laser™ Atherectomy CatheterChange in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baselinebaseline0.57 ratioStandard Deviation 0.14
B-Laser™ Atherectomy CatheterChange in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baseline30 days0.94 ratioStandard Deviation 0.14
B-Laser™ Atherectomy CatheterChange in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baseline6 months0.84 ratioStandard Deviation 0.2
B-Laser™ Atherectomy CatheterChange in Ankle-Brachial Index (ABI) Post B-Laser™ Device Procedure Compared to Baseline12 months0.77 ratioStandard Deviation 0.16
